Transatrial-Transpulmonary correction of TOF with CMR as a definitive diagnostic tool: Replacement of conventional cardioangiography

Journal Title: Journal of Medical Sciences - Year 2015, Vol 18, Issue 1

Abstract

INTRODUCTION: The objective of this study was to evaluate the associated cardiac anomalies, coronary and pulmonary artery abnormalities and aortopulmonary collaterals in patients of TOF with preoperative CMR and to correlate the CMR findings with intra-operative findings. METHODS: 28 patients (male: female ratio of 1:1.33) who had TOF were prospectively evaluated using CMR and underwent complete repair using the transatrial-transpulmonary approach. Efficacy of CMR as a tool for preoperative assessment of patients with TOF was evaluated by comparing CMR findings with intra-operative findings. RESULTS: On pre-operative CMR associated congenital cardiac anomalies were present in 13 patients including additional muscular VSD, coronary artery abnormalities, LSVC, PFO, PDA, right aortic arch and MAPCA's.Pulmonary artery variations were detected in 9 patients with LPA stenosis being the commonest lesion present in 3 patients followed by supravalvular stenosis and Isolated MPA hypoplasia. All the associated cardiac anomalies were confirmed intra-operatively except one MAPCA's in which PDA was found. One Mitral valve cleft found and repaired intra-operatively was missed by CMR and one LPA stenosis was over diagnosed on CMR. Post-repair RV/PA gradient was 10mmHg in 27 (96.43%) patients and one patient had 11mmHg. Mean post-repair Prv/Plv ratio was 0.51. CONCLUSIONS: In patients of TOF, CMR is superior to traditional echocardiography and alternative to conventional angiography which gives detailed anatomic and functional information without risk of radiation and contrast reactions to iodinated agents.
